World famous mezzo soprano Katherine Jenkins is swapping her designer frocks for a pair of trainers to help children affected by kidney cancer and renal failure. And she needs your support.

The patron of the Kidney Foundation will be running in the charity’s HSBC 10K Run alongside more than 4,000 runners and supporters on September 6.

Katherine said: “I’m so excited about taking part in this year’s HSBC 10K. The Kidney Foundation is a charity that is so close to my heart and this year’s 10K is the most important ever. Every penny raised will go to helping patients at the Children’s Kidney Unit in , which Kidney supports.”
